Thought i'd share my new tower/amp setup with everyone. Just installed four of the Exile SXT65 tower speakers along with an Exile Harpoon amp (500x2) to power them. I know some will say that these aren't HLCD's and your right. I didn't feel the need for them and after adding these to the tower i'm glad i did! These things are loud and super clear! Tried them on the lake yesterday boarding, surfing and yes even tubing and all behind the boat said they could hear them loud and clear.

Just for giggles I anchored in a cove and climbed the hill way up behind the boat and they were super clear way beyond 150', maybe even double that but the bushes stopped my progess Very Happy

The SXT65 has a more dynamic range than your normal HLCD, i wasn't looking to blast the lake just something that sounded great and covered the riders zone and these definately do it. I'm only running the Harpoon at 50% and i can't imagine how loud they be with more power!

The cool part is they don't overpower the cabin at speed and with the Throttle Box on the Harpoon you can shape the sound field for boarding, surfing or hanging out. The hidden wiring is a big plus as well. Definately way cool.

If your looking for something that doesn't break the bank you might look into these, cheers!

Full retail pricing is $550 a pair for the SXT65's and $700 for the Harpoon amp, $1800 total. There are dealers such as Earmark Marine Audio that sell for less though. Sounds like a lot until you price out HLCD's and amps to drive them and you realize you can easily spend double that.
